  21. /**
  22. * @file
  23. * XBM parser
  24. */
  25. #include "libavutil/common.h"
  26. #include "parser.h"
  27. typedef struct XBMParseContext {
  28. ParseContext pc;
  29. uint16_t state16;
  30. int count;
  31. } XBMParseContext;
  32. #define KEY (((uint64_t)'\n' << 56) | ((uint64_t)'#' << 48) | \
  33. ((uint64_t)'d' << 40) | ((uint64_t)'e' << 32) | \
  34. ((uint64_t)'f' << 24) | ('i' << 16) | ('n' << 8) | \
  35. ('e' << 0))
  36. #define END ((';' << 8) | ('\n' << 0))
  37. static int xbm_init(AVCodecParserContext *s)
  38. {
  39. XBMParseContext *bpc = s->priv_data;
  40. bpc->count = 1;
  41. return 0;
  42. }
  43. static int xbm_parse(AVCodecParserContext *s, AVCodecContext *avctx,
  44. const uint8_t **poutbuf, int *poutbuf_size,
  45. const uint8_t *buf, int buf_size)
  46. {
  47. XBMParseContext *bpc = s->priv_data;
  48. uint64_t state = bpc->pc.state64;
  49. uint16_t state16 = bpc->state16;
  50. int next = END_NOT_FOUND, i = 0;
  51. s->pict_type = AV_PICTURE_TYPE_I;
  52. s->key_frame = 1;
  53. s->duration = 1;
  54. *poutbuf_size = 0;
  55. *poutbuf = NULL;
  56. for (; i < buf_size; i++) {
  57. state = (state << 8) | buf[i];
  58. state16 = (state16 << 8) | buf[i];
  59. if (state == KEY)
  60. bpc->count++;
  61. if ((state == KEY && bpc->count == 1)) {
  62. next = i - 6;
  63. break;
  64. } else if (state16 == END) {
  65. next = i + 1;
  66. bpc->count = 0;
  67. break;
  68. }
  69. }
  70. bpc->pc.state64 = state;
  71. bpc->state16 = state16;
  72. if (ff_combine_frame(&bpc->pc, next, &buf, &buf_size) < 0) {
  73. *poutbuf = NULL;
  74. *poutbuf_size = 0;
  75. return buf_size;
  76. }
  77. *poutbuf = buf;
  78. *poutbuf_size = buf_size;
  79. return next;
  80. }
  81. AVCodecParser ff_xbm_parser = {
  82. .codec_ids = { AV_CODEC_ID_XBM },
  83. .priv_data_size = sizeof(XBMParseContext),
  84. .parser_init = xbm_init,
  85. .parser_parse = xbm_parse,
  86. .parser_close = ff_parse_close,
  87. };
